Understanding Today’s Commercial Property Landscape Commercial real estate no longer serves a single purpose. Office spaces, retail units, warehouses, and mixed-use developments are increasingly designed to adapt to changing business needs. This flexibility has influenced how listings are presented and evaluated. Buyers and investors now look beyond location and square footage. Factors such as zoning flexibility, potential income streams, and future adaptability play a growing role in decision-making.
